Remarks

I have got my admission to Andhra University via the EAMCET exam. I secured a rank of 4395. The ranks of eamcet decide which branch of engineering you can get in AU. The priority order (depending on ranks) is CSE, ECE, EEE, MECH, CIV, and CHEM. Although your interest is the main concern rather than rank. Other than EAMCET you can join Andhra University via AUEET, conducted by Andhra University itself. Application form, application fees, and application dates all will be available on the official Eamcet (now called EAPCET) Website I didn't have any reservation benefits but some of my friends get their fee money from schemes like JVD (jagananna vidya deevena) based on their family income. The admission process is good enough, So I don't want any changes majorly.

Course Curriculum Overview

3.5

I have chosen civil engineering because I am interested in irrigation and the main reason is I would like to go for government jobs like a junior engineer and assistant engineer which I thought will be easy as a civil engineer. the faculty-student ratio is good enough. For each class, there would be a professor for sure and if necessary 1 to 2 scholars will also come to guide us Qualification of the faculty is the best thing to be considered at Andhra University. Each and every professor has done their higher educations in top IITs, and other prestigious universities and their experience is off the charts Every professor in their respective period will definitely teach something related to civil engineering I would say that the teaching method is very good, and we will definitely get enough time to do our hobbies Semester exams will be conducted for every 6months Due to covid, we have semester exams every 5 months. It is quite easy to pass the exams just by reading notes given by professors.

Internships Opportunities

3

Many internship opportunities will be available to the students starting from 2nd year itself. Companies offering internships, IBM ICF Flextronics Coca-Cola colostrum group and L&T These other companies might also come to offer internships. As far as my knowledge is concerned, the stipend will be 10,000 rupees to 25000 rupees only. Projects will be given in the 8th semester which should definitely be done to get the degree.

Placement Experience

3

From the 7th semester, students become eligible for campus placements. Top companies like Cognizant, Accenture, IBM, Wipro, TCS, and L&T will visit for campus placements and will hire 20 to 30 students per department. The highest package would be around 8 LPA and the average package would be 3 LPA. The percentage of students getting placements will be around 70 to 75 %. After getting the degree, if I got a placement, everything is set. Otherwise, I will try jobs on the IT side and core side as well and finally will settle with a government job.

Fees and Financial Aid

The annual tuition fee is 10,000 rupees. For hostel accommodation (for girls), the fee is 4250/-. and mess bill (for food including breakfast, lunch, and dinner) costs 80/- per day. The 10k tuition fee remains almost constant every year and may change at a rate of 1000/- for every 2 years. Overall, the cost to study is 10,000 rupees per annum. If Scholarships like JVD (Jagananna Vidya Deevena) are applicable, a total of 10k will be paid by the government itself. And we can write other scholarship tests too which will bare most of the fees. Financial assistance can be achieved from many trusted websites. Some of My seniors got jobs of 6 LPA and others who didn't get jobs on the core side got jobs on the IT side of 5 LPA.

Campus Life

3.5

AURORA is the annual fest that includes technical contests along with many cultural events like dances, singing, and quizzes (both academic and general knowledge). DJ will also be there for the annual fest. Fests regarding our civil engineering department will be conducted in the month of September every year which include paper presentations, model making, quizzes, and poster making. Likewise, respective departments will conduct their tech fests in other months. Central Library on the South campus of Andhra University is one of the best libraries. You can find all kinds of books (also including journals, thesis, biographies, encyclopedias, and constitution books) there and can read them peacefully. The classroom and labs will have all the necessary requirements. Projectors and computers are also available. Sports will be conducted by respective departments before department day only. Extracurricular activities like teaching and learning English, and coding can be done by a social group/club named "Edumoon".
